WebNov 16, 2024 · A marginal effect of an independent variable x is the partial derivative, with respect to x, of the prediction function f specified in the mfx command’s predict option. If no prediction function is specified, the default prediction for the preceding estimation … WebJul 10, 2024 · $\begingroup$ Over calculates the marginal effects within each over group, so only makes sense for categorical variables. You maybe want something like margins, dydx(A) at(B=(0(0.1)5)), where I pretended the range of B is from 0 to 5 (and generate the effects at every 0.1 interval in between).So this is the marginal effect of A conditional on …

WebAll you will do is to trick Stata that the interaction term and the constituent terms are not related, but the results you will get will be nonsensical. That is why you need to use factor variables to generate the interactions when computing marginal effects. Last edited by Andrew Musau; Yesterday, 06:24 . 1 like. WebFeb 14, 2024 · Marginal effects in a linear model Stata’s margins command has been a powerful tool for many economists. It can calculate predicted means as well as predicted marginal effects. However, we do need to be careful when we use it when fixed effects are included. In a linear model, everything works out fine.

WebOct 16, 2024 · Marginal effects in a Cox model is problematic, as it depends on the baseline hazard, and the whole purpose of Cox regression is to avoid estimating the baseline hazard.
